Football party in Wijdewormer, youthful AZ beats another Spanish top club from the Youth League

At a sold-out training complex in Wijdewormer, AZ won 4-0 against Real Madrid in the Youth League. Daniël Beukers, Ernest Poku and Mexx Meerdink scored twice for the Alkmaar talents. With this victory, AZ advances to the semi-finals of the youth set-up of the Champions League.

It has never been so busy at the AZ training complex before. More than two thousand spectators watched the Alkmaar talents of the future with great interest. With many prominent figures in the stands, such as former national coaches Guus Hiddink and Raymond Domenech. At AZ, players such as Mexx Meerdink, Kees Smit and Fedde de Jong played on the artificial turf field in Wijdewormer. The latter player started last weekend in the base in Pascal Jansen’s team. Then De Jong took the right back position against FC Groningen, on Wednesday afternoon against Real Madrid he played as the most attacking midfielder.

Lightning-fast Poku

It took a while for the match to explode. AZ had a slight predominance on the field, but did not express that in chances or goals. That only happened in the second part of the first half. After a fumbling from the Spanish goalkeeper, the ball came from a corner kick at the feet of Daniël Beukers. This allowed the defender in a sitting position to open the score. After this, AZ pressed on and that resulted in a beautiful goal from Ernest Poku. At top speed, the winger sprinted out his personal Spanish guard and finished convincingly.

Final blow

At the beginning of the second half a completely different picture at the AZ training complex. Real Madrid pushed the home team back quite a bit and were regularly dangerous for Owusu-Oduro. A connection goal was in the air, but it lacked Spanish precision. AZ was also dangerous a few times in the counter. Only ten minutes before the final blow fell. By a ticker of goaltjesdief Mexx Meerdink. Just before time it turned into a football party. With a beautiful bang from the left corner in the sixteen-meter area, Beukers put the 4-0 final score on the scoreboard. The second goal for the often emerging left back.

Due to the very handsome and historic win, AZ will advance to the semi-finals of the Youth League. Never before have the youngsters from Alkmaar reached the last four of this most important European youth tournament. Opponent is on April 21 in Nyon Sporting Portugal, Switzerland.

Setup AZ: Owusu-Oduro; Mastoras, Stam, Schouten, Beukers; Smit, De Jong, Kwakman (Kalisvaart/90); Addai (Tom Kerssens/73), Meerdink, Poku (Daal/81).
